25 years after its first turn at the Opéra de Lyon, the Théâtre de Chaillot presents one of Angelin Preljocaj’s first (and undoubtedly most beautiful) ballets: the sublime ‘Romeo and Juliette’. With set design by Enki Bilal, costumes by Fred Sathal and media artist Goran Vejvoda on sound, this sublime Preljocaj ballet features twenty-four dancers in an Eastern bloc-inspired setting. Shakespeare’s original plot themes of rival families and star-crossed lovers are intertwined with a new, intense social class conflict between the rich Capulets and the poor Montagues - a creative decision which manages to enhance the ballet without clouding its romantic soul.
